Question:
How do I delete/modify/suspend a user?
Answer:
In order to delete/modify/suspend a user, you will have to be part of the Administrators Role. If your Observer account is not a part of that Role, you will not be able to perform these steps. Deleting an account will remove it from the Observer software completely. Modifying a user account entails in changing the username, password, emails or any details of the user account. Suspending a user is a temporary way to prevent access to the Observer software and not deleting their account permanently.
- Log into the Observer web interface.
- Click on the Gear icon in the top right corner and select Settings.
- You will see the users list in the middle, use the Search on the left to locate your account.
- Once you have located the user account, hover your mouse over the account and you'll see and edit and trash icon.
- Click on the Edit icon if you need to modify or suspend the user or click on Delete to remove the user from the Observer software. If you select delete, it will pop up a delete confirmation window just to make sure that is what you would like to do.
- The Edit user window will appear if you select the edit icon.
- From this window, you can modify the account details, change the password, change the Role they are a part of and also change the Status from Active to Inactive which will temporarily suspend the user account.
- Don't forget to select Save after you are done modifying/suspending the user account.
Note: If you are using Active Directory, these instructions do not apply.
